Complex Setup Challenges
Many homeowners find range installation complicated due to outdated wiring, improper venting, or mismatched appliance requirements. For example, gas ranges need dedicated gas lines and proper venting to prevent carbon monoxide buildup, while electric ranges require 240V service. Without professional expertise, these details can be overlooked, leading to inefficiencies or safety risks. Safe and Efficient Use
Proper installation ensures your range operates safely and efficiently, reducing the risk of fire, gas leaks, or electrical overloads. By adhering to local building codes and manufacturer specifications, we help preserve your appliance’s warranty and extend its lifespan. For example, ensuring 30-inch clearance from walls and 66-inch clearance from the ceiling prevents overheating and improves ventilation. These details are critical for both safety and the long-term performance of your range.
